- Jewish Film and Music Festival. The Jewish Film and Music Festival returns with more than 50 films, concerts, and conversations highlighting international voices and stories. Opening night will premiere Jake Paltrow’s June Zero followed by a talk-back with the director. In celebration of Israel’s 75th anniversary, the Shalva Band, an eight-person Israeli music group with disabilities, will headline the music portion of the festivities (Thurs through May 21, $30+ for passes, various locations).
